Description:
============
High volumes, several per second, of the error:

    salq_list_open() failed, qlistsh=0 err=0

are being reported in the TIBCO iProcess Objects Server (iPOS) log, SWDIR\logs\SWEntObjSv01.log
(where SWDIR is the installation directory of the TIBCO iProcess Engine).

Environment:
==========
   o All supported platforms.
   o All versions of TIBCO iProcess Engine prior to version 11.0.1.6 (Contact TIBCO Support for exceptions).

Symptoms:
=========
Together with the high volume of error messages in the TIBCO iPOS log the actual TIBCO iProcess Objects Server process may fail abnormally.

Cause:
=====
The salq_list_open() failed, qlistsh=0 err=0 errors mean that the TIBCO iPOS is trying to open a workqueue by communicating with the Work Item Server (WISRPC) process. However, the WISRPC does not have the workqueue cached and returns a code to the iPOS causing it to perform an infinite loop that may result in the iPOS process failure.

Resolution:
=========
The issue has been fixed in the TIBCO iProcess Engine from version 11.0.1.6 onwards.

A workaround to the problem is to stop and restart all the TIBCO iProcess Engine processes.
